Sutiyoso ready to answer police
JAKARTA: Governor Sutiyoso was ready to face police
questioning over alleged corruption involving Rp 4.2 billion
earmarked for Jakarta's flood victims, city council spokesman
Muhayat said Friday.
"Governor Sutiyoso has received the police summons but we do
not know yet the place of the questioning," Muhayat said.
"The questioning can take place at city police headquarters or
here at City Hall. We must consider the governor's tight
schedule."
The questioning is slated to take place next Tuesday.
The funds, collected during a charity show in March, were
later handed to the Institute of Civic Education on Indonesia
(ICE on Indonesia), a non-governmental organization.
Police have named ICE on Indonesia's treasurer, Hendrawan, a
suspect while its director, Irma Hutabarat, has been named a
witness.
The case surfaced when another non-governmental organization,
Government Watch (Gowa), accused ICE on Indonesia of swindling
the public funds.
Irma has filed a defamation suit against Gowa chairman Farid
R. Faqih. -- JP
